[−][src]Struct contest_algorithms::order::SparseIndex
A simple data structure for coordinate compression
Implementations
impl SparseIndex
[src]
pub fn new(coords: Vec<i64>) -> Self
[src]
Builds an index, given the full set of coordinates to compress.
pub fn compress(&self, q: i64) -> Result<usize, usize>
[src]
Returns Ok(i) if the coordinate q appears at index i Returns Err(i) if q appears between indices i-1 and i
